
Two Independent Controls with Differential Pressure Settings
|

With two independent hydraulic circuits, these power units are ideal for horizontal machining centers with two pallets that sometimes must operate at different pressures.

7500 and 5000 psi max Single and Double Acting
FEATURES: Electric Powers Units are the best power source for most workholding applications, complete with all electrical and hydraulic controls. Quiet, long-life radial piston pump powered by a totally enclosed fan-cooled universal motor. Large reservoir provides enough fluid capacity for virtually any fixture. Leak-free poppet valves and fittings.
TWO INDEPENDENT CONTROLS WITH DIFFERENTIAL PRESSURE SETTINGS: The configuration shown here has two remote pushbutton clamping switches, for two independent hydraulic circuits. The second circuit can be set to a lower pressure via an integral poppet-type Pressure Reducing Valve. This option is ideal for machining centers with shuttle pallets that sometimes must operate at different pressures. The single-acting version has two solenoidoperated clamping valves, to provide two independent clamping-pressure ports "A" and a return port "R" (return port is required when separate clamping valves are used to clamp multiple parts independently – leave the pushbutton switch in clamped position so that the "A" port supplies constant pressure). The doubleacting version has four solenoid-operated clamping valves, providing two independent clamping pressure ports "A", two independent unclamping-pressure ports "B", and a return port "R".

OPERATION: The heart of this unit is a precision, long-life radial-piston pump controlled upon demand by an integral pressure switch. This switch is infinitely adjustable from the minimum to the maximum operating pressure. Automatic pressure control is assured, because the pump restarts if pressure drops. Clamping pressure is assured even with an electrical power failure since the solenoid valves are mechanically held in "clamped" position, requiring power only to unclamp. The poppet design of these valves ensures positive, leak-free sealing.
MOUNTING & SETUP: Mount power unit upright, preferably above fixture level to keep the unit clean. We offer a sturdy, attractive Power-Unit Stand (CLR-3532-168-PUA) that bolts to the floor. Power units can also be mounted on the machine tool using an angle bracket. Connect to a fused electrical supply and fill with clean, approved Hydraulic Fluid. Do not use NPT fittings for hydraulic connections.
SAFETY FEATURES: Fail-safe operation in case of electrical-power failure since the solenoidoperated clamping valves are de-energized in "clamped" position. These valves are poppet type, so they provide tight zero-leakage sealing. Pump motor has a thermal-overload relay with manual reset.
DUTY CYCLE: Electric Power Units are designed specifically and purely for workholding, with intermittent clamping and unclamping between machining cycles (not continuous running). For most workholding applications, actual running time is a small percentage of total cycle time. Run time must be less than 40% of total cycle time at maximum fluid level (25% at minimum fluid level). Run time must also be less than 120 continuous seconds at maximum fluid level (15 seconds at minimum fluid level). Otherwise the fluid will overheat and the unit will shut off automatically. |
